Whole Exome Sequencing

Whole Exome Sequencing

Exons are the protein coding regions of the genome and are together are termed as the exome, accounting for only ~1-3% of an organism’s genome.

WES helps in sequencing exome which contains 80-85% disease/function-related variants and thus helps in identifying important disease-causing mutations in diverse studies like population genetics, genetic diseases, and cancer.
